9 BRIMHILL RISE is a large extended detached house of 176m², built sometime between 1991 and 1995, which could now be worth an estimated £609,754. It was last sold for £294,000 in December 2002, which was around 17% above the average December 2002 detached price in the Wiltshire local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was December 2023, where the current energy rating was D, and the potential energy rating was D.

What might 9 BRIMHILL RISE be worth now?

9 BRIMHILL RISE might now be worth an estimated £609,754.

This is based on house price inflation of 107.4%, between December 2002 and February 2025, for detached houses, in the Wiltshire local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 107.4%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 9 BRIMHILL RISE of £294,000 on 18th December 2002. For the value to have increased from £294,000 to £609,754 over the 23 years and ten months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 9 BRIMHILL RISE has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Wiltshire local authority area.
  • The December 2002 sale price of £294,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 9 BRIMHILL RISE has not materially changed since December 2002.

9 BRIMHILL RISE: Plot and Title Map

9 BRIMHILL RISE sits on a plot of roughly 0.177 of an acre, or 716m². The below map shows the location of 9 BRIMHILL RISE,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 9 BRIMHILL RISE).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
